The administrative office of the Michigan Supreme Court place James on administrative leave while it expanded its earlier audit of the court. State investigators said the improper spending included money for Inkster High School cheerleader uniforms, a school European trip fund, a 1970 class reunion and the Inkster Police Auxiliary. Sanctions can include a private censure, a public reprimand, paid or unpaid suspension, mandatory retirement or removal from office. If the commission determines wrongdoing, it makes a recommendation to the Michigan Supreme Court. The Michigan Judicial Tenure Commission, made up of five judges, two attorneys and two citizens oversees the complaints, investigates and holds hearings. Wade McCree, Wayne County Circuit Court judge, removed from the bench in 2014 after carrying on an affair with a female litigant appearing before him, then lying about it to the Judicial Tenure Commission.
